I had my first credit card four years ago and I promise to myself that I will only use it when it is really necessary. Sometimes I broke my own promise :-) This has caused unnecessary debt for me and I was struggling to payback all my debt at that time.

Nowadays it is too easy to get a credit card and if not used carefully you will end up with lots of debt. You don’t have to apply for one anymore, instead the bank employee will come running to you to encourage you to apply from their bank or any of the financial institution they are working for.

With the growth of online shopping, you should be more wary on how to use your credit card. Even with my experience with my first credit card that I mentioned above, I still believe a credit card is a necessity as long as you know how to manage your expenditure.
